Rainer Kempe Doubles Through Koray Aldemir

Koray Aldemir raised to 10,000 under the gun before Rainer Kempe moved all in next to act for 25,500. Action folded back to Aldemir, and he called. Aldemir: [qc][qh] Kempe: [ac][9h] The board ran out [jc][as][2d][3s][2c] and Kempe doubled through.
